Understanding Veneers and Their Varieties
Veneers are basically thin shells that stick to the front of your teeth to make them look better. They’re a popular choice if you want to fix things like chips, cracks, gaps, or discoloration. Think of them as a quick way to get a smile makeover. There are a couple of main types to consider. Porcelain veneers are known for looking super natural and lasting a long time, but they can be pricier. Veneers Denver are a great option for those looking to improve their smile.
- Porcelain Veneers: These are like the premium option. They look incredibly realistic and can last for years with good care. They’re stain-resistant, too, which is a big plus.
- Composite Veneers: These are more budget-friendly. The process is usually faster since they can often be applied in a single visit. However, they might not last as long or look quite as natural as porcelain.
- Snap-On Veneers: These are a temporary solution that you can fit at home. They’re the most affordable option, but they don’t offer the same level of customization or durability as other types.
Choosing the right type depends on your budget, how long you want them to last, and the look you’re going for. It’s a good idea to chat with your dentist about what’s best for you.

The Step-by-Step Veneer Application Process
Alright, let’s get into the actual process. Getting veneers is a multi-step thing, but it’s not too bad.
- Prep Time: They’ll shave off a tiny bit of enamel from your teeth. This makes room for the veneers.
- Impressions: They’ll take molds of your teeth. These molds are used to create your custom veneers.
- Temporary Time: You might get temporary veneers while the real ones are being made. These are like stand-ins.
- Fitting: Once your veneers are ready, the dentist will check the fit and color.
- Bonding: They’ll use special cement to glue the veneers to your teeth. A special light hardens the cement.
- Follow-Up: You’ll go back for a checkup to make sure everything is still looking good.

Factors Influencing the Cost of Veneers
Several things can affect how much veneers cost. Here’s a quick rundown:
- Type of Veneer: Porcelain veneers usually cost more than composite veneers because they last longer and look more natural.
- Dentist’s Experience: A dentist with more experience might charge more, but you’re also paying for their expertise.
- Location: Prices can vary depending on where the dental office is located in Denver.
- Number of Veneers: Obviously, the more veneers you get, the higher the total cost will be.
- Prep Work: Sometimes, you might need other dental work done before you can get veneers, which can add to the cost.

Frequently Asked Questions
What are veneers and how do they work?
Veneers are thin shells made of porcelain or composite resin that cover the front of your teeth. They help improve the look of your smile by changing the color, shape, or size of your teeth.
How long do veneers last?
With good care, veneers can last between 5 to 15 years. It’s important to practice good dental hygiene and visit your dentist regularly.
Are veneers painful to apply?
The process of getting veneers is usually not painful. Your dentist will use local anesthesia to ensure you are comfortable during the procedure.
Can anyone get veneers?
Most people can get veneers, but it’s important to have healthy teeth and gums. A dentist will evaluate your oral health to see if veneers are right for you.
How do I take care of my veneers?
Caring for your veneers is similar to caring for your natural teeth. Brush and floss regularly and avoid hard foods that could chip them.
